Aldous Huxley wrote a book about his experiences with Mescaline in 1954. the title of the book, DOORS OF PERCEPTION, did indeed inspire Jim Morrison in the naming of his band,. .but this term was invented neither by Jim Morrison or Aldous Huxley,.. it is from a poem by William Blake,.. where he says,.. that "when the doors of perception are cleansed, then man will see things as they truly are,... infinite." it's cool .
